Species profile

Herms soft tick

Ornithodoros hermsi

A nocturnal, rapidly feeding soft tick associated with rodent nests and rustic cabins in mountainous western North America.

Quick facts

Family: Argasidae. Genus: Ornithodoros. Soft tick.

Identification

Soft-bodied tick without a dorsal scutum. Mouthparts are not visible from above. Nymphs and adults feed briefly, often without the person noticing.

Sex and appearance differences

Soft ticks show less obvious sexual dimorphism than hard ticks. Multiple nymphal instars may occur.

Life cycle

Multihost soft-tick life cycle with a larval stage and multiple possible nymphal instars before adulthood. Feeding is brief at nymphal and adult stages.

Seasonal activity

Exposure can occur when people sleep in infested buildings; the ticks and infected colonies can persist for long periods.

Distribution

Associated with mountainous areas of western U.S. states at moderate to high elevations, especially rodent-infested rustic cabins.

Countries and regions

  • United States — established_regional

    Associated with mountainous areas of western U.S. states at moderate to high elevations, especially rodent-infested rustic cabins.

  • Oregon — present

    Oregon Health Authority records Ornithodoros hermsi in high-elevation areas east of the Cascades.

  • Washington — present

    Washington Department of Health records the soft tick Ornithodoros hermsi in elevated forested areas of Washington.

Medical and veterinary relevance

Bites are brief and often painless or unnoticed. The species is a confirmed vector of soft tick relapsing fever.

Primarily associated with rodents; direct veterinary importance is secondary to its zoonotic role.

Vector and pathogen evidence

Confirmed vector of Borrelia hermsii, a cause of soft tick relapsing fever in the United States.
